The New Brunswick New Democratic Party in Fredericton, NB is a political organization dedicated to promoting the values and policies of the New Democratic Party at the provincial level.
They work towards advocating for social justice, environmental sustainability, and economic equality through political campaigns, community outreach, and policy development.
Generated from their business information